Airport to Downtown – From PIT to Downtown, plan for 25–40 minutes under typical traffic and about 18–22 miles. A private ride minimizes stops and keeps you on schedule; a shared ride lowers fares but adds time for other riders. Most travelers choose private for a quick, predictable start, but a shared option works well when youre traveling solo and want to save. The pickup occurs at the terminal curb; when you arrive, follow the signage to the designated pickup point displayed on the site. Fares are shown at booking, and you can pay by credit online or in-app. Cancelation terms are displayed during booking.

Airport to Oakland – Oakland is adjacent to Downtown, with heavier traffic during class hours. Expect 30–45 minutes and about 14–20 miles. Private rides still deliver the fastest arrival; shared rides may add 10–20 minutes for stops. If youre visiting campuses in the area like Pitt, CMU, or UPMC, timing matters, so a private ride is often best for youre visits. Booking online lets you compare multiple options and mark your pickup location; the site shows exact pickup spots. Fares displayed online and credit cards accepted; cancelation terms appear during booking.

Airport to Shadyside – Shadyside sits along the eastern edge of the city; trips here run 25–40 minutes and cover about 12–18 miles. A direct ride keeps you on schedule; shared rides still offer savings if youre traveling light and want to split costs. You can set pickup near Mellon Park or the East Side corridors; use the location tools on the site to pin the exact stop. Fares are available online, and you can pay with a credit card. Cancelation terms appear at booking, so you know your options if plans change.

Stops and route rationale

Stop Instantánea de la ruta Typical ride time ¿Por qué visitar? Best time to ride
Downtown / Golden Triangle Direct access via I-376 W 12–25 min Central hotels, dining, government buildings, and transit links Morning or early evening
Strip District Along Penn Ave corridors from Downtown 8–18 min Food halls, breweries, markets, river views Late morning to afternoon
Oakland (Pitt/CMU) Uptown corridor toward University Circle 15–25 min Campus vibes, museums, cafes Midday
Shadyside / East Liberty Commercial strip via Fifth Ave 10–22 min Boutiques, restaurants, leafy streets Evening
South Side Crossing Monongahela River approaches 12–24 min Nightlife, riverfront parks, easy hotel access Weekends
